A Tranquil Oasis in Orlando
Harry P. Leu Gardens, located in Orlando, is a tranquil natural attraction encompassing over 50 acres, featuring diverse plant life and beautiful landscapes. Visitors can enjoy the rose garden, palm garden, and flowering trees, as well as participate in various activities like plant sales and educational workshops. US Universities Expand Social Justice Scholarships to Promote Equity
American universities are promoting educational equity by establishing social justice scholarships to support relevant research. Institutions like Syracuse University's Lender Center offer scholarship programs that fund faculty research on topics such as AI ethics and historical discriminatory policies, encouraging interdisciplinary collaboration and community engagement. These efforts aim to cultivate students' social responsibility, drive social change, and achieve a more equitable society. The scholarships often prioritize projects that address systemic inequalities and promote inclusive practices within higher education and beyond.

MSU Revives Indigistory Project to Digitally Preserve Indigenous Oral Histories
Michigan State University's revitalized Indigistory project is dedicated to preserving and perpetuating Indigenous cultures through oral history and digital storytelling. Coupled with land acknowledgments, the project aims to foster academic research, cultural revitalization, and social justice within Indigenous communities. It emphasizes the role of digital technologies in cultural dissemination and highlights the responsibility of educational institutions in advancing decolonization efforts. The project seeks to empower Indigenous voices and ensure their stories are heard and valued in the digital age.

US Schools Face Rising Chronic Absenteeism Crisis
Post-pandemic, chronic absenteeism in US K-12 schools has surged to nearly 20%, triggering an academic crisis. This highlights the urgent need to address the underlying causes of absenteeism. Drawing insights from the successful strategies implemented in Newark, New Jersey, the article emphasizes the importance of collaborative efforts between parents and schools to monitor student attendance and safeguard their academic future. By proactively addressing absenteeism, we can mitigate its negative impact on student achievement and overall educational outcomes.
